The authors consider those Riemann surfaces of genus \(g=1+q^2\), where \(q \geq 5\) is a prime integer, admitting a group \(G\) of conformal automorphisms of order \(3q^2\). Sylow's theorem permits to observe that \(G\) is either isomorphic to \({\mathbb Z}_{q}^{2} \rtimes {\mathbb Z}_{3}\) or \({\mathbb Z}_{q^{2}} \rtimes {\mathbb Z}_{3}\). In either case, they provide an explicit algebraic description of these groups and observe that the quotient orbifold \(S/G\) has genus zero and exactly three cone points, each one of order three. A description of the strata in moduli space is provided and the groups of conformal automorphisms are studied in each situation. A decomposition of the Jacobian variety of \(S\) is also provided.
